Guided a husband and wife-Chris and Sandy out of Timberlake resort yesterday for a half day. With a gorgeous sunny sky and a nice walleye chop from a west wind, we fished hard, but found fishing to be tough. We did boat 6 walleyes keeping two-16" and a 15". A lot of smaller bluegills and some Lm bass and some Sm bass releasing them.

We caught all the fish on jigs and leeches with the bobber rig not producing anything. Caught most fish out over the woody humps but had a lot of success fishing a shallower bar that has wood, weeds, and rock. Just maybe the weed walleye pattern will start to kick in soon. That will be determined by the forage factor.

The water temps have cooled down to 75 degrees and I expect the walleyes to put on the feed bag. If you want to go on a walleye hunt, give me a call and we will see if the big mama's want to come out and play. Good luck fishing everyone.
